> > -----Original Message----- > > From: Ferriter, Cian > > Sent: Friday 28 January 2022 16:32 > > To: William Tu <u9012...@gmail.com>; d...@openvswitch.org > > Subject: RE: [ovs-dev] [PATCH] acinclude: Detect avx512 vpopcntdq compiler > support. > > > > > > > -----Original Message----- > > > From: dev <ovs-dev-boun...@openvswitch.org> On Behalf Of William Tu > > > Sent: Thursday 27 January 2022 03:45 > > > To: d...@openvswitch.org > > > Subject: [ovs-dev] [PATCH] acinclude: Detect avx512 vpopcntdq compiler > support. > > > > > > Ubuntu Xenial 16.04 is using GCC 5.4 and it does not support > > > target "-mavx512vpopcntdq" and cuases error > > > lib/dpif-netdev-lookup-avx512-gather.c:356:47: > > > error: attribute(target("avx512vpopcntdq")) is unknown > > > GCC 7+ supports vpopcntdq: > > > https://gcc.gnu.org/gcc-7/changes.html > > > The patch detects vpopcntdq and disables AVX512 when not found. > > > > > > Reported-by: Greg Rose <gvrose8...@gmail.com> > > > Signed-off-by: William Tu <u9012...@gmail.com> > > > --- > > > acinclude.m4 | 2 +- > > > 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-) > > > > > > diff --git a/acinclude.m4 b/acinclude.m4 > > > index 5c971e98ce91..0c360fd1ef73 100644 > > > --- a/acinclude.m4 > > > +++ b/acinclude.m4 > > > @@ -77,7 +77,7 @@ dnl Checks if compiler and binutils supports AVX512. > > > AC_DEFUN([OVS_CHECK_AVX512], [ > > > OVS_CHECK_BINUTILS_AVX512 > > > OVS_CHECK_CC_OPTION( > > > - [-mavx512f], [ovs_have_cc_mavx512f=yes], > [ovs_have_cc_mavx512f=no]) > > > + [-mavx512f -mavx512vpopcntdq], [ovs_have_cc_mavx512f=yes], > [ovs_have_cc_mavx512f=no]) > > > AM_CONDITIONAL([HAVE_AVX512F], [test $ovs_have_cc_mavx512f = > yes]) > > > if test "$ovs_have_cc_mavx512f" = yes; then > > > AC_DEFINE([HAVE_AVX512F], [1], > > > -- > > > > Hi William, > > > > Thanks for this fix, I can verify that this fixes the below error for GCC 5 > > (it will > work for GCC 4.9 > > - GCC 6): > > make[3]: Entering directory '/root/cian/ovs/datapath' > > lib/dpif-netdev-lookup-avx512-gather.c:90:1: error: > attribute(target("avx512vpopcntdq")) is unknown > > > > We would like to re-spin a new version of this patch that fixes the compile > error for the relevant GCC > > versions (GCC 4.9 - GCC 6) but allows some AVX512 code to be build. > > For setups with GCC 6 for example, we still have support for most of the > AVX512 ISA used in OVS, so we > > can still enable building of this ISA, while still correctly avoiding the > avx512vpopcntdq error that > > your patch does. > > > > Please allow us a few days to test and re-spin a new version of this patch. > > Thanks, > > Cian > > Hi again William, > > I have been looking into a new version of this patch to add partial support to > GCC versions that don't have full support for all the AVX512 ISA we use in > OVS. > This is still a work in progress. > > While I'm looking into this more, I think it doesn't make sense to hold back > this > patch from being merged. It fixes build issues. > > I think the patch should be applied as is. We can add further improvements > later. > > Acked-by: Cian Ferriter <cian.ferri...@intel.com> > > More details about what I tested: > I switched to GCC 5 on my system and can see the compile issue below before > applying the patch. > After applying the patch, the build is successful. > Before patch > Configure message: > checking whether gcc accepts -mavx512f... yes > > Build error: > make[3]: Entering directory '/root/cian/ovs/datapath' > lib/dpif-netdev-lookup-avx512-gather.c:90:1: error: > attribute(target("avx512vpopcntdq")) is unknown > > After patch > Configure message: > checking whether gcc accepts -mavx512f -mavx512vpopcntdq... no > > On GCC 4.8 before the patch is applied, the build is actually successful, > since the > "avx512f" only check fails, so the AVX512 build is disabled. > On GCC 4.8 after the patch is applied, the build still works as expected. > Before patch > Configure message: > checking whether gcc -std=gnu99 accepts -mavx512f... no > > After patch > Configure message: > checking whether gcc -std=gnu99 accepts -mavx512f -mavx512vpopcntdq... no > > I also checked that all was working as expected with the compile time AVX512 > flags: > --enable-dpif-default-avx512 --enable-autovalidator --enable-mfex-default- > autovalidator > > I can confirm that these compile time flags don't cause issues. > > Finally, I tested and confirmed that OVS was still building and running with > AVX512 support when built with GCC 9.
